A functional centromere lacking CentO sequences in a newly formed ring chromosome in rice.
Journal of genetics and genomics = Yi chuan xue bao - 20 Dec 2016
Yang Rui, Li Yafei, Su Yan, Shen Yi, Tang Ding, Luo Qiong, Cheng Zhukuan
Abstract excerpt
An awned rice (Oryza sativa) plant carrying a tiny extra chromosome was discovered among the progeny of a telotrisomic line 2n+4L. F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) using chromosome specific BAC clones revealed that this extra chromosome was a ring chromosome derived from part of the long arm of chromosome 4. So the aneuploidy plant was accordingly named as 2n+4L ring. We did not detect any CentO FISH...
